Ver Mensaje Individual
  #1 (permalink)  
Antiguo 12/06/2014, 08:50
jadelbarrio
 
Fecha de Ingreso: junio-2014
Mensajes: 2
Antigüedad: 9 años, 11 meses
Puntos: 0
Pasar datos de la base de datos a un textbox

Buenas tardes,

Estoy intentando realizar una consulta sql con sql server compact edition y listar todas las filas en un textbox. El lenguaje que he utilizado es visual basic, el código es el siguiente:

Código:
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
        Dim con As New SqlCeConnection("Data Source=C:\Documents and Settings\Admin\My Documents\WINDOWSMOBILE24 My Documents\pastillero.sdf;")
        Dim consulta As SqlCeCommand = con.CreateCommand
        Dim reader As SqlCeDataReader
      
        consulta.CommandText = "SELECT pacientes.* from pacientes"
        
        con.Open()

        reader = consulta.ExecuteReader
        
        While (reader.Read())
            Me.TextBox1.Text = reader.GetValue(0).ToString + vbTab + reader.GetValue(3).ToString + vbTab + reader.GetValue(1).ToString + vbTab + reader.GetValue(2).ToString + vbCrLf

        End While

  con.Close()



    End Sub
la base de datos tiene una tabla que se llama "pacientes" y dentro de la tabla hay 4 campos.
con éste código, lógicamente sólo me aparece la última linea de la consulta, parece que sobreescribe lo que está en el textbox en cada iteración y se lista sólo la última línea. Lo que quiero es listar desde la primera hasta la última. Cómo puedo hacerlo?

muchas gracias